G

Greg Deusen

Hace 1 año

I have been using Top Communications for quite som...

I have been using Top Communications for quite some time now, and I have always been impressed with their excellent service. The quality of their products is top-notch, and their customer support team is always helpful. Highly recommended!

Comentarios:

Sin comentarios